Output d6efa38e4c7bf94de61b0a160cfcedcac051fe5ae5bb450956a8ed68feeb772a:0

value
3145243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6c298b88fbb7e2f6564df95ca859da954e53871 OP_EQUAL
address
3QBmGYJTyRmiN58BP6ENu8x1PFNbcLC21W
transaction
d6efa38e4c7bf94de61b0a160cfcedcac051fe5ae5bb450956a8ed68feeb772a
spent
true